Candidateexperience describes how a job seeker perceives an employer’s hiring process. From initial sourcing to onboarding, this impression—for better or worse—has a critical impact on your company’s ability to recruit successfully. Things that can lead to a negative experience include: Complicated, lengthy applications.

A significant part of your hiring process is the candidateexperience. What is the candidateexperience? Put simply, it’s the whole array of experiences and interactions between your company and any given candidate, from the time they see your job ad to the time they are either hired or not.
